"Dumplings & Things is a cash-only takeout spot on 5th Avenue where almost everything on the menu is under $6. The dumplings, which come steamed or fried, are served on their own or in noodle soup form, and they also serve bao. We always order the pan-fried spicy beef dumplings." - Matt Tervooren
